This podcast, developed by the ECTA Design Committee, is a lively discussion on the CJEU Cofemel decision and how the intricacies of the interaction between Copyright and Design Law have been interpreted by National Courts.
All speakers are members of the ECTA Design Committee:
Shane Smyth (IE)
Niccolò Ferretti (IT)
Janne Brit-Hansen (DK)
Patrick Wheeler (UK)
Filipe Baptista (PT)
Jan Schumacher (DE)
